The Political Economy of Mexico's Financial Reform
This title was first published in 2001. An analysis of the political economy of Mexico's financial reform. It is organized in three parts. The first part develops the framework, both historical and institutional. The second part presents the analysis of three main institutional changes to the financial system - development banking reform, commercial banking privatisation and autonomy of the central bank. Each specific case study shows how the reforms conformed to the ideas of the dominant consensus on economic policy and how they delivered an inefficient incentive structure. The third part - chapter eight - brings together all the elements to explain Mexico's 1994 financial crisis.
